Output 5d4386c7da19b660c033c620f5aef65d1796fc489e779b18a688e9f0421e2a0b:1

value
266256859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d74f3e2f9c5c6bf1bb4acc31dbcc83f98e93f8e OP_EQUALVERIFY OP_CHECKSIG
address
1DtxP4ebtPTM6jPgxzRaDGExszZMw3rQHX
transaction
5d4386c7da19b660c033c620f5aef65d1796fc489e779b18a688e9f0421e2a0b
spent
true